Default Emilia-Romagna in September

We are planning to visit this region sometime in September. The plan is to fly from Frankfurt, Germany to Milano and rent a car there, then drive South. We would like to find a nice quaint Agri-Hotel (recommendations greatly appriated) in the countryside. We do plan to visit the larger cities, especially the old historical sections, in Parma, Modena, Bologna and Ravenna. Our thought is, with a car we can go pretty much anywhere we want, and perhaps we can take a train or bus into the cities and walk. Is this a do-able plan? Any suggestions or ideas are really welcome. We will be in Germany (at my mother's) from the 20th of August and are scheduled to return to the US on Sept.24. I chose Sept for our Italy trip thinking that the main tourist season might be tapering off? We are very flexible as to the time, and are planning to make the travel arrangements from Germany. The only advice I can offer (I have been through several of those places before) and thats if you take a car, try to book hotels that offer car parking spaces as part of the rate. Driving in the cities is ok, parking is much harder. Not much advice as you probably need, but a tip!
